The Role Of Outplacement Firms In Supporting Displaced Workers

In the ever-changing landscape of the workforce, job security is becoming increasingly scarce. Companies are constantly restructuring, downsizing, or even shutting down operations altogether, leaving many employees without a job. During these challenging times, outplacement firms play a crucial role in supporting displaced workers.

outplacement firms are companies that specialize in helping individuals who have lost their jobs transition into new employment opportunities. These firms provide a range of services to support displaced workers, including career counseling, resume writing, job search assistance, and interview preparation. The goal of outplacement firms is to help individuals navigate the job market and secure new employment as quickly as possible.

One of the key benefits of using an outplacement firm is the personalized support and guidance that they offer. Each individual’s situation is unique, and outplacement firms tailor their services to meet the specific needs of each client. This personalized approach can make a significant difference in helping displaced workers find new opportunities that align with their skills and experience.

outplacement firms also provide valuable resources and tools to help individuals improve their job search skills. From resume writing workshops to mock interviews, these firms offer a variety of tools to help individuals present themselves in the best possible light to prospective employers. In today’s competitive job market, having a strong resume and polished interview skills can make all the difference in landing a new job.

In addition to providing practical support, outplacement firms also offer emotional and psychological assistance to individuals dealing with job loss. Losing a job can be a traumatic experience, and outplacement firms provide a safe space for individuals to process their emotions and frustrations. This emotional support can be invaluable in helping individuals maintain a positive attitude and stay motivated during a job search.

outplacement firms also serve as a bridge between employers and displaced workers. Many companies offer outplacement services as part of their severance packages to help ease the transition for employees who are being let go. By working with an outplacement firm, companies can demonstrate their commitment to supporting their employees through difficult times and maintaining a positive employer brand.
